Performs laboratory tests in designated clinical areas; appropriately reports panic values; performs quality control according to protocol; performs calibration according to procedures; performs daily, scheduled and periodic maintenance on various equipment.
Promotes excellent customer service throughout the facility; assists with training of students from various colleges and technical schools; assists with the development of departmental policies and procedures; maintains procedures and quality control records in clinical areas; acts as a resource for Medical Technologists and Technicians in designated clinical area; helps Medical Assistants as needed.
Collects blood specimens (e.g. venous, capillary, etc.) and urine specimens following proper collection procedures; performs collections for health screens at external locations.
Performs patient functions in Health Information System / Laboratory Information System (HIS/LIS) (e.g. registrations, order entry, updates tests, prints labels, enters and releases results, etc., as stated in computer manual, etc.).
Answers telephone; takes and relays messages; communicates test results.
Maintains adequate inventory levels.
